Hey Folks, the first event is set to go off August 5-6. Ed Sullivan is organizing this event and writes:
I've been working under the radar with Jeff and a few others to establish a combined wakesuf and wakeboarding competition in Columbus, Ohio. There are just a few more thing that I need to work out before formally releasing event information but I thought that I’d share some basic event information now.
The 2006 Scioto Wakefest will be a two day event, held on August 5th and 6th at Griggs Reservoir on the Scioto River in Columbus Ohio. On the first day we will feature a wakesurfing contest, wakeboarding clinics, board demos, and other equipment demonstrations. On the second day we will swap the surfing and wakeboard competitions-clinics, while continuing to hold equipment demos.
I’ve set up a yahoo email address for this event at SciotoWakeFest@yahoo.com.
I’ll have more information out in the next few weeks.
I'll be bringing a number of boards from Inland Surfer, Trick Boardz, Walker Project, Shred Stixx, Calibrated and Walzer...still working on securing more by the time August rolls around. It'll be a great opportunity for folks who want to try out boards that they can't normally get their hands on. |

Hey folks I wanted to let everyone know that we finally got a contest organized here locally in NorCal, relatively speaking. The series will be held up at Villa Lagos, near Red Bluff, CA. It will be the first and ONLY wakesurfing series in the country. We have 4 stops, basically each month starting this weekend on May 20th. The contest dates can be found at the http://www.intleague.com/ncalifornia/.
We have some great prizes, including boards from Inland Surfer, Xtreme Board Company, Calibrated wakesurfing, Shred Stixx, the Walker Project and a gift certificate from Trick Boardz for the board of your choice. We are trying to encourage as much participation as possible, so the boards (and other swag) are being awarded at random to the participants at each stop. You don't have to win or place to score a $500 board!
Each participant will get a commemorative T-shirt at each stop and the winners will receive trophies or medals for finishing first, second or third. The points leaders at the end of the series will be declared the series winners.
